Verdict

Both are the scribe your record system offers you, and neither is a candidate for anyone outside that record system, so this comparison is really about which bundled option is the stronger product. Sunoh is the more developed one: published pricing at 149 dollars per provider per month, a free trial, order pre fill across labs, imaging, medications and referrals, and the widest enumerated specialty reach of any embedded scribe here including dental and vision. Veradigm is thinner on specialty coverage and accuracy, and the scribe is built by a separate company, AvodahMed, named in Veradigm's own click through agreement rather than anywhere in the product marketing. That agreement is also where Veradigm's price sits, at one dollar per encounter, and where the term that matters most appears. Audio recordings and other encounter data are collected, owned by the client, and licensed to Veradigm to use for training and product improvement. Veradigm's explainer material describes the opposite, capture without any audio recording at all. The agreement is the more specific surface and it governs.

The case for Sunoh.ai
  • Published pricing and a free trial, 149 US dollars per provider per month or roughly 1.25 dollars per visit, with no contract and no credit card, against a module priced at one dollar per encounter, which a practice can only compare once it knows its own visit volume.
  • Specialty reach that is enumerated and genuinely wide, covering dermatology, rheumatology, behavioral health with DAP notes, dental periodontal charting and treatment plans, and vision, where the alternative publishes no specialty count or tuning claim at all.
  • Multilingual capture that produces documentation rather than translation only. Veradigm states plainly that its multilingual capture yields English output, so a visit conducted in another language still produces an English note.
The case for Veradigm Ambient Scribe
  • The product agreement names AvodahMed as the company powering the scribe and prices the product at one dollar per encounter, so both the supplier and the rate are on the record rather than settled case by case in a platform negotiation.
  • It is honest about a limitation most vendors bury. Stating that multilingual capture produces English documentation tells a buyer what the note will actually look like, which is more useful than an unqualified language count.
  • Codes arrive as ICD-10 suggestions for provider review with no evidence of ambient order or prescription drafting, which is the more conservative position of the two.

Should we choose Sunoh.ai or Veradigm Ambient Scribe?

On the axes where the AI Health Index separates them, Sunoh.ai grades higher on several axes, including AI Centrality, AI Safety and PHI Stewardship and Commercial Transparency, and Veradigm Ambient Scribe grades higher on Autonomy and Oversight Model and Model Supply Chain Disclosure. Sunoh.ai leads on the greater share of scored axes, but the split means the decision turns on which constraint is binding rather than on an overall winner.

Where do Sunoh.ai and Veradigm Ambient Scribe differ most?

The widest separation the AI Health Index records between Sunoh.ai and Veradigm Ambient Scribe is on AI Centrality, where Sunoh.ai grades A and Veradigm Ambient Scribe grades C. That axis sits in the AI Capability group, so it should carry the most weight for a buyer whose binding constraint is how much of the work the model itself is trusted to do.

Where do Sunoh.ai and Veradigm Ambient Scribe grade the same?

The AI Health Index grades Sunoh.ai and Veradigm Ambient Scribe the same on several axes, including Model and Technology Transparency, Clinical and Operational Evidence and HIPAA and BAA Posture. Neither holds an advantage the index can evidence on those axes, so they should not carry weight in a selection between these two.

Disclosure

An earlier version of this comparison described Veradigm's scribe as powered by a third party the product materials do not name, said no product specific business associate agreement was located, and presented capture without an audio recording as a claim worth having verified. Veradigm's own click through agreement for the product contradicts all three. It names AvodahMed, states business associate status, and provides that audio recordings and other encounter data are collected and licensed to Veradigm for training. Corrected 15 September 2026.

Veradigm's disclosure stops at the AvodahMed link. No foundation model, hosting arrangement or subprocessor list is published for either party, and no hosting region was located. Veradigm's parent trades over the counter rather than on a national exchange, which is a procurement fact rather than a product one. Sunoh's SOC 2 claim appears only on third party comparison pages, several published by competitors, and its own adoption figures are inconsistent across its own site. Neither vendor publishes an accuracy figure or a bias and fairness position.
